Output 17f1477598e00e06abb76f161e530717539ec9a61d6019cfa269a909f58b5a16:0
- value
- 13868762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b4aefad5cefa2eb7184e9151a3d2b60f82b60ee OP_EQUAL
- address
- 3EPXcsNkTMUcEjF89pQJokV3yfCYAF94aV
- transaction
- 17f1477598e00e06abb76f161e530717539ec9a61d6019cfa269a909f58b5a16